MELBOURNE, Fla. – Late game heroics and a huge sixth inning allowed for Saint Leo softball to sweep Florida Tech Saturday night to take the Sunshine State Conference series two games to one. The Lions rallied late in nine innings of the game at Nancy Bottage Field before late-game momentum carried the Green and Gold to a 12-5 game two decision. Â

Saint Leo 6, Florida Tech 2 – 9 innings
The two teams squared off for the third game of the series and the Panthers jumped out to a quick 2-0 lead through three innings. The Lions would rally for one in the fourth and one in the fifth to tie things at 2-2 before an explosion in the top of the ninth for four runs.

Keeping Our Lions Healthy & Safe
Saint Leo University Athletics is keeping our student-athletes healthy and safe by following a number of measures to prevent the spread of COVID-19. This includes having student-athletes tested or screened on a regular basis, traveling in smaller groups, holding competitions without fans in attendance, avoiding overnight trips, and wearing masks when not competing. These safety standards meet those set by the NCAA Division II and the Sunshine State Conference President's Council. At Saint Leo University, the COVID-19 Incident Command Team also reviews the teams' safety protocol and monitors adherence on a regular basis.
